百度网站如何出现图片,这是一个涉及搜索引擎技术、内容生产与分发、用户体验优化等多个层面的综合性问题,百度通过其强大的爬虫系统抓取互联网上的图片资源,经过复杂的索引和处理后,当用户在搜索框输入与图片相关的关键词时,通过特定的算法将最相关、最优质的图片展示在搜索结果中,这一过程并非一蹴而就,而是由多个环节紧密协作完成的。

图片能够出现在百度搜索中,最基础的前提是这些图片存在于互联网的各个网站上,并且这些网站允许百度爬虫抓取其内容,百度拥有名为“百度蜘蛛”(Baiduspider)的爬虫程序,它们日夜不停地在全球互联网中漫游,发现新的网页和图片资源,当爬虫访问一个包含图片的网页时,它会分析图片周围的文本信息,比如图片下方的说明文字、所在网页的标题、正文内容等,这些文本信息是理解图片内容的重要线索,爬虫也会读取图片本身的文件名,以及图片标签中的“alt”属性——这个属性是网页设计师专门为图片设置的替代文本,旨在当图片无法显示时,用文字来描述图片内容,这对于搜索引擎理解图片至关重要,如果图片的文件名是一串无意义的字符如“img123.jpg”,而“alt”属性也为空,那么百度爬虫将很难准确判断这张图片的内容,自然也就难以将其精准地展示给相关用户。
百度对抓取到的图片会进行一系列的技术处理,以建立高效的图片索引数据库,这个过程类似于图书馆对图书进行分类编目,百度会对图片进行特征提取,包括颜色、纹理、形状、物体识别等视觉特征,同时也会结合前面提到的文本信息进行综合分析,一张包含蓝色天空、白色云朵和黄色向日葵的图片,通过视觉特征分析可以识别出这些元素,而如果其所在的网页标题是“梵高《向日葵》高清欣赏”,正文中有大量关于印象派画家梵高及其作品《向日葵》的描述,那么百度就能将这张图片与“梵高 向日葵”这个关键词高度关联起来,百度还会对图片进行压缩和格式转换,以优化存储和加载速度,并会为图片生成缩略图,以便在搜索结果中以更快的速度展示给用户,这个庞大的图片索引数据库是百度能够快速响应用户图片搜索请求的核心。
当用户在百度搜索框中输入一个关键词,大熊猫”,百度会迅速在其图片索引数据库中进行匹配,匹配的依据并非单一维度,而是综合了多种因素,首先是相关性,即图片内容与用户搜索关键词的匹配程度,这取决于前面提到的图片特征提取和文本分析结果,其次是权威性和质量度,百度会优先选择来自权威网站、高质量图片源头的图片,例如国家地理、新华网等官方媒体或知名图片库的图片,通常会比普通博客上模糊不清的图片排名更靠前,图片的分辨率、清晰度、美观度等也是重要的考量因素,高清、构图优美的图片更受用户青睐,时效性也是一个重要指标,对于一些时效性强的关键词,如“2023年诺贝尔奖获得者”,百度会更倾向于展示最近发布的图片,百度还会考虑用户的个性化因素,如搜索历史、地理位置等,以提供更具针对性的图片结果,用户在北京搜索“烤鸭”,百度可能会优先展示北京知名烤鸭店的图片。
为了让用户更高效地筛选图片,百度图片搜索结果页还提供了丰富的筛选和排序功能,在搜索结果页的左侧,用户可以根据图片的尺寸(如大图、中图、小图)、格式(如JPG、PNG、GIF)、颜色(如红色、蓝色、黑白)、时间(如一天内、一周内、一月内)以及版权信息(如可商用、标注作者)等维度进行筛选,在顶部,用户可以选择按“综合”、“最新”、“相关”等顺序对结果进行排序,这些功能极大地提升了用户的搜索体验,帮助用户快速找到最符合需求的图片。

除了通过关键词搜索直接展示图片,百度还会以其他形式将图片融入搜索结果中,在搜索“天气”时,搜索结果中会直接展示当前天气状况的图标和未来几天的天气预报图表;在搜索“明星名字”时,会展示该明星的头像和相关照片墙;在搜索“旅游景点”时,会展示该景点的精美图片集,这些场景都体现了百度对图片资源的深度整合与应用,使其不仅仅是搜索结果的一部分,更是信息传递的重要载体。
对于网站所有者而言,希望自己的图片能够更好地被百度收录并展示,就需要遵循一些最佳实践,除了前面提到的为图片设置有意义的文件名和完整的“alt”属性外,还应确保图片所在网页的加载速度不宜过慢,因为过大的图片会拖慢网页打开速度,影响用户体验和搜索引擎的抓取效率,为图片提供适当的上下文文字描述,让搜索引擎能够更全面地理解图片内容,避免使用Flash或JavaScript来展示图片,因为这些技术可能阻碍爬虫的抓取,合理使用图片的标题属性和图片周围的链接文本,也有助于提升图片在搜索结果中的表现。
百度网站出现图片是一个复杂而精密的系统工程,它始于互联网上海量的图片资源,经过百度爬虫的抓取、索引系统的处理、算法的精准匹配,最终通过多样化的形式呈现给用户,并通过丰富的筛选功能满足用户的个性化需求,这一过程不仅依赖于强大的技术实力,也需要内容生产者的积极配合,共同构建了一个丰富、高效、智能的图片生态。
相关问答FAQs

问题1:为什么我上传到网上的图片在百度图片搜索中找不到? 解答: 图片无法在百度图片搜索中被找到,通常有以下几个原因:可能是百度爬虫尚未抓取到您所在的网页,特别是对于新发布的网站或新上传的图片,爬虫需要一定时间来发现和索引,您所在的网站可能设置了禁止爬虫抓取的规则,例如在网站的robots.txt文件中限制了百度蜘蛛的访问,或者使用了nofollow标签阻止了图片链接的传递,图片本身的信息不足,比如文件名是随机字符,且“alt”属性为空,导致百度无法理解图片内容,图片所在的网页内容过少或与图片无关,也可能影响图片的收录,您可以检查网站的robots.txt文件,确保允许百度爬虫抓取,并为图片设置有意义的文件名和“alt”属性,同时确保图片被放置在内容丰富、主题相关的网页中。
问题2:如何在百度图片搜索中让我的图片排名更靠前? 解答: 要提升图片在百度图片搜索中的排名,可以从以下几个方面进行优化:第一,提升图片质量,使用高分辨率、清晰度高、构图美观的原创图片,避免使用模糊或有水印的图片,第二,优化图片文件名,将文件名修改为包含目标关键词的描述性名称,北京烤鸭_正宗挂炉烤鸭.jpg”,第三,完善图片标签,务必填写准确、详细的“alt”属性,用简洁的语言描述图片内容,并自然地融入关键词,第四,优化图片所在网页,确保网页内容与图片主题高度相关,并在网页标题、正文等地方合理布局关键词,为图片提供良好的上下文环境,第五,提升网页权威性,通过高质量的外部链接和优质内容来提高网页的权重,百度通常更青睐权威网页上的图片,第六,合理利用图片的标题属性和图片链接的锚文本,这也有助于搜索引擎理解图片的重要性,可以考虑在百度站长平台提交图片链接,加速百度对图片的收录和索引。
原文来源:https://www.dangtu.net.cn/article/9125.html